Lithium-ion batteries are found in many rechargeable household devices, like personal electronics. If mishandled, they can overheat, catch fire and explode!
Reduce your fire risk:
- Don't modify or tamper with a battery. Don't use if showing signs of damage like swelling or overheating.
- Charge away from soft surfaces like bedding. Store at room temperature.
- If replacing a charger, check for a Canadian certification mark like CSA, cUL or cETL.
- Check with your municipality on how to safely dispose of your batteries.
